The Genesis of a Light Artist

Grimanesa Amorós was born in Lima, Peru, and her upbringing in a vibrant Latin American culture has significantly influenced her artistic narrative. Her artistic journey began during her time studying art, where she discovered her passion for exploring the intersection of light and space.

After moving to the United States, Amorós developed her distinctive style that incorporates both contemporary technology and traditional techniques. Her works often reflect her personal experiences, social issues, and the rich history of her native Peru, creating a unique blend that is both personal and universal.

The Philosophy Behind the Art

At the heart of Grimanesa Amorós's work is a profound belief in the transformative potential of light. She uses light not merely as a tool but as a language that communicates emotional depth and human connection. Her installations often encourage viewers to reflect on their surroundings, prompting them to interact with the art in meaningful ways.
